Core License Attributes

FFL Number

Description: A unique identifier for the license (e.g., "1-23-456-78-9-12345").

Format: Typically includes a sequence denoting region, license type, and issuance order.

License Type

Description: A code indicating the FFL category (e.g., Type 01, Type 07).

Federal Firearms License (FFL) Types

Type Description
01 Dealer in Firearms Other Than Destructive Devices (Includes Gunsmiths)
02 Pawnbroker in Firearms Other Than Destructive Devices
03 Collector of Curios and Relics
06 Manufacturer of Ammunition for Firearms
07 Manufacturer of Firearms Other Than Destructive Devices
08 Importer of Firearms Other Than Destructive Devices
09 Dealer in Destructive Devices
10 Manufacturer of Destructive Devices
11 Importer of Destructive Devices

See 27 CFR § 478.41 for full list.

License Status

Description: Current state of the license (e.g., Active, Expired, Revoked, Surrendered).

Issue Date

Description: Date the license was granted by the ATF.

Expiration Date

Description: Date the license expires (FFLs are valid for 3 years unless renewed or revoked).

Operational Details

SOT Status

Description: Indicates if the licensee pays a Special Occupational Tax (SOT) to handle National Firearms Act (NFA) items (e.g., machine guns, silencers).

Classes:

  • Class 1: Importer of NFA items.
  • Class 2: Manufacturer of NFA items.
  • Class 3: Dealer in NFA items.

SOTs must renew annually by July 1.

Permitted Activities

Description: Actions allowed under the FFL type (e.g., gunsmithing, manufacturing, retail sales).

Compliance History

Description: Internal ATF records of inspections, violations, or enforcement actions (not publicly disclosed).


Additional Attributes

FFL Sequence Number

Description: A sub-identifier in the FFL number showing the order of issuance within a region.

C&R Eligibility

Description: For Type 03 licenses, confirms eligibility to collect Curios and Relics (firearms ≥50 years old).

Export/Import Codes

Description: For importers/exporters, codes related to international trade compliance.


Notes on Accessibility

  • The ATF's FFL eZ Check system allows limited verification of active licenses (e.g., confirming an FFL number's validity) but does not disclose full details.
  • Sensitive data (e.g., responsible persons' backgrounds, compliance history) is confidential and protected under law.
  • The database structure is designed for regulatory enforcement, not public use, to balance transparency with privacy and security.

For authoritative details, consult the ATF's FFL Resource Center or 27 CFR Part 478.
